## Step 4: Migrate the scanner config

This step moves SquatGuard, the typo-squatting package scanner, from file-based config to the Ledgerline config service. First stop the scanner daemon on the standby node and confirm the crawl queue is empty — in-flight package comparisons will resume after restart, so nothing is lost. If paging fires during this window, it is expected; acknowledge and continue. Do not migrate the primary until the standby passes a full scan cycle. Recreate the following values in Ledgerline exactly as shown:

deployment values, kajep-kageg:
[praix]
host = praix.paliqcorp.corp
user = praix_svc
database = praix_prod

# Break-Glass: Catalog Cache Invalidation

Scope: the Pinrow product catalog at Veldstone Retail. If stale prices persist after a purge and the Hollowmere invalidation queue is wedged, use break-glass to flush the edge tier directly. Contractors: get verbal sign-off from the catalog lead first. Steps: open the Hollowmere admin shell, select emergency-flush, confirm the tenant, and run it once — repeated flushes thrash the origin. Access is logged and expires after 20 minutes. Unseal the admin shell with the passphrase below.

recovery phrase for kahop-tajog: istix-casvan

TICKET FNT-207: Font vendoring job can't reach metadata DB

Support: the GlyphCache vendoring job that mirrors third-party fonts into our CDN is failing. It can't connect to the font-metadata database, so license checks abort and new fonts never publish. Started after Tuesday's network ACL change at the Harwick site. Workaround: none; escalate to infra. To verify connectivity from the batch host, test against the metadata database with the string below.

replica DSN, yahaf-yagaf: mongodb://tamath_svc:a2netSk3RZMuTj@db-d084.novacsoft.internal:5432/ralmir

[ ] Verify connection pool configuration before promoting the Ledgerfen release. Confirm the pool ceiling matches the database's max-connections budget divided across all replicas — overcommitting here has caused outages before. Check that idle timeout is shorter than the load balancer's, that the pool warms on startup rather than on first request, and that leak detection logging is enabled in staging. Record your findings in the release sheet, and verify the deployed artifact against the build token printed below.

pipeline stamp: htk4_ae36